Just like you prepare your normal tea, take the igredients in the same quantity. Only the preparation style differs here!
Take a pan, add tea powder and sugar. Mix them well together until sugar starts melting.
Once the sugar starts melting, add elaichi (2 pieces) and a small piece of ginger to it.
Now add water to it and stir well so that no lumps are formed.
After mixing tea, melted sugar, elaichi, ginger and water well, add milk to it. Keep stiring.
Now cover this with a lid. Let it boil for about 3-4 minutes.
Now put off the flame and serve hot! Serve in a cutting glass or kulhad if possible to get Dhaba feels.
